Patrick Aquino to serve as interim Blackwater Elite manager


Decorated head coach Pat Aquino will serve as Blackwater Elite’s team manager on an interim basis, team owner Dioceldo Sy confirmed to Tiebreaker Times, Sunday.

“Interim manager si Pat Aquino,” wrote Sy in a text message.

Aquino has been with the NU Lady Bulldogs, a team co-managed by Ever Bilena, since 2013.

This comes at the heels of Joel Co’s resignation from the said position. Co decided to leave the post to spend more time with his family, as he told Tiebreaker Times.

Co had his last game with the Elite last Friday, March 22, versus Magnolia Hotshots. He ends a 10-month stint with the team.

“Maraming salamat sa Blackwater Elite sa pag-suporta and at the same time sa kanilang pag-unawa,” expressed Co.

“I think coach Pat is the guy for the position. He is very, very capable.”

Meanwhile, Aquino will not be by his lonesome, as Sy has brought in his son-in-law Jacob Munez to serve as an assistant to the seasoned tactician, who has been with Blackwater since 2014.

“I want Pat to train Jacob,” Sy wrote.

Aquino is aware of the work that has to be done with the Elite. The team is coming off a disappointing 2-9 campaign in the 2019 PBA Philippine Cup, but he accepts the challenge.

“I hope I can make a difference and a new look for Blackwater Elite,” said Aquino, who’s also the NU Lady Bulldogs’ head coach and the chief bench strategist of Perlas Pilipinas.
